Position Overview: Our client is seeking a highly skilled Structural Forensic Engineer to conduct detailed investigations of structural failures and damages, prepare comprehensive reports, and provide expert testimony. The successful candidate will have a strong background in forensic engineering, excellent communication skills, and experience working with attorneys and insurance companies.
Key Responsibilities:
- Conduct thorough investigations of structural failures and damages to determine the cause and extent of the issues.
- Prepare detailed forensic engineering reports, including findings, conclusions, and recommendations for remediation.
- Provide expert testimony in legal proceedings, including depositions and court appearances.
- Collaborate with attorneys, insurance adjusters, and other stakeholders to communicate findings and provide technical support.
- Develop and maintain strong client relationships, ensuring high levels of satisfaction and repeat business.
- Lead and manage forensic engineering projects from inception to completion, ensuring timely and accurate delivery of services.
- Stay current with industry standards, codes, and regulations to ensure compliance and best practices.
- Mentor and train junior engineers, fostering a culture of continuous learning and professional development.
- Identify and pursue new business opportunities, including networking, proposal writing, and client presentations.
